Output 8dd1ebcfaa73a206f63712d6c2e0c3c64e09c40c828e56790bd1d001b3fa9aa2:0

value
2149773
script pubkey
OP_HASH160 OP_PUSHBYTES_20 712596e08eabeba6e2886ffb515a7518962f752f OP_EQUAL
address
3C1HJyXTQGHd14tumRvkxZfnTooxdfU82B
transaction
8dd1ebcfaa73a206f63712d6c2e0c3c64e09c40c828e56790bd1d001b3fa9aa2
spent
true